How the Cooling System Works

The cooling system's primary function is to regulate the engine's temperature by circulating coolant to absorb heat. This process involves several components, including the thermostat, water pump, and radiator, working together to ensure the engine does not exceed its operating temperature. The thermostat regulates coolant flow based on the engine's temperature, ensuring it heats up quickly and then maintains optimal operating conditions by allowing hot coolant to flow to the radiator to be cooled.

Purpose of the Radiator Overflow Tank

The radiator overflow tank serves as a storage for excess coolant that expands and overflows due to increased pressure and temperature within the cooling system. This tank, also known as the reservoir or recovery tank, ensures pressure regulation and optimal temperature maintenance, preventing engine overheating. When the system cools down, the coolant is drawn back into the radiator, ready for the next cycle.

Importance of the Radiator Overflow Tank

Historically, cooling systems without an overflow tank would vent excess coolant directly to the atmosphere, necessitating frequent top-ups and posing environmental concerns. The introduction of the overflow tank allows for the recirculation of coolant, reducing waste and environmental impact while maintaining system pressure and temperature.

Upgrading the Radiator Overflow Tank

Most vehicles come with a plastic radiator overflow tank. However, aftermarket options made from aluminum or stainless steel are available. The advantages of upgrading include repairability and aesthetics. Metal tanks can be repaired through welding, potentially reducing waste. However, they may not offer significant performance improvements over plastic tanks. The decision to upgrade often boils down to personal preference regarding engine bay appearance.

Overflow Tank vs. Expansion Tank

The main difference between an overflow tank and an expansion tank is that the latter is pressurized. Expansion tanks can offer additional cooling capacity and efficiency by allowing for more coolant in the system and facilitating air separation from the coolant.

Improving Your Car’s Cooling System

For those with performance modifications or facing overheating issues, upgrading components of the cooling system can be beneficial. Options include silicone radiator hoses for increased durability, performance water pumps for better coolant circulation, and auxiliary cooling fans for enhanced heat dissipation.
